One last holiday decoration

Editor: The Holiday Decoration in January

 

There’s one last decoration hanging still,

Hiding, drooping, looking ill,

In protest and stubborn will.

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

 

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

I spy it near the window sill,

Its hour is past with holiday thrill,

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

 

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

It seems to be a bitter pill,

A forgotten and only frill.

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

 

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

It shall remain there until . . .

Surrounding it is nothing, nil.

There’s one last decoration hanging still.

Wendy Welk,

Langley
